Mr. Musk has usually stated that Twitter must be extra open and crammed with a higher variety of voices and factors of view. However Mr. Musk’s Twitter feed is usually an echo chamber. He commonly sees, likes and replies to messages which can be about him or are posted from accounts that always act as his cheerleaders, in accordance with a New York Occasions assessment of his exercise on the platform.

To be able to assess how the social community might evolve underneath Mr. Musk’s watch, The Occasions reviewed almost 20,000 of his public tweets, analyzing posts from latest years and pictures he printed over the previous decade, in addition to the comparatively small variety of customers that he follows.

What Mr. Musk says on Twitter has an enormous attain, now greater than ever: His viewers is without doubt one of the largest, with almost 128 million accounts following him. It’s the place he solicits recommendation, conducts polls, condemns censorship and proclaims sweeping coverage modifications on the platform. As an influence person who now controls the corporate — he just lately known as himself the “chief twit” — Mr. Musk has vowed to remake the social community in his imaginative and prescient.

Of the 178 accounts that Mr. Musk adopted as of Tuesday, most have been associated to his companies, or have expressed admiration of his enterprise model, the Occasions assessment discovered. The listing is closely male: Solely two dozen that aren’t institutional or organizational accounts belong to ladies. He’s associated to 2 of them — his mom, Maye, and sister, Tosca — and was married to a 3rd.

Amid discussions of Twitter insurance policies, web satellites from SpaceX and Tesla software program updates, his posts have a freewheeling high quality to them. He traffics in juvenile humor and vulgar jokes (photos of tape dispensers laid in sexual positions), scientific marvels (the Massive Hadron Collider), common topics on far-right websites (Pepe the Frog) and critiques of divisive cultural points (“I’m not brainwashed!!”).

Mr. Musk’s posting model is conversational, and commonly satirical. He messages with former Democratic cupboard officers, criticizes information organizations and trades barbs with enterprise capitalists.

“The buying of Twitter was an influence transfer, politically,” stated Joan Donovan, the analysis director of the Shorenstein Heart on Media, Politics and Public Coverage at Harvard. “He is without doubt one of the richest males on the planet shopping for a social media firm in a transfer that’s expressly about politics and affect on tradition and on media.”

It’s unclear precisely what Mr. Musk sees in his feed. The precise sequence relies on whether or not he has chosen to obtain algorithmic suggestions or simply tweets from accounts he follows. (He has beforehand tweeted that individuals are being “manipulated by the algorithm.”)

His exercise more and more consists of replying to customers who’ve talked about him. When he responds to accounts that he doesn’t observe, he regularly chooses people who have complimented or praised him: In dozens of situations over the previous six months, in accordance with the Occasions evaluation, he has replied to tweets from customers whose account descriptions point out that they help or put money into corporations owned by Mr. Musk, or that they’re followers of his management.

There are occasions when he second guesses what he broadcasts.

Over the previous two years, he has deleted lots of of tweets inside hours of posting them. In accordance with the PolitiTweet web site, which archives all of Mr. Musk’s tweets, he has additionally deleted dozens of tweets within the months since he acquired Twitter.

On Nov. 14, for instance, Mr. Musk tweeted that he could be “working and sleeping” at Twitter’s headquarters in San Francisco till the location was fastened.

An internet site monitoring Mr. Musk’s non-public jet motion advised that he traveled away from San Francisco round that point. He deleted the tweet 18 hours after first posting it.

However for an individual with as giant a follower base as Mr. Musk has, deleting tweets might do little to alter how broadly seen or influential these posts develop into when they’re first printed.

“Hundreds of thousands of individuals see his tweets, not many will discover when they’re deleted,” Ms. Donovan stated.

Many tweets which have landed Mr. Musk in scorching water stay on-line.

In 2018, just a few weeks after Mr. Musk had smoked marijuana throughout an on-camera interview for Joe Rogan’s podcast, Mr. Musk tweeted that he had the funding to take Tesla non-public at $420 a share.

Specialists started to query whether or not his total feed was being produced in jest, and identified the repeated marijuana references in his tweets (together with his proposed funding value).

That incident led to prices from the Securities and Alternate Fee, and later a settlement that included monitoring of what Mr. Musk might publish about Tesla on Twitter. Shareholders are actually additionally in search of billions of {dollars} in damages in a lawsuit after Mr. Musk’s takeover proposal by no means materialized.

Final week, Mr. Musk joined an investor name as Tesla reported its latest quarterly earnings, which confirmed a good bounce in earnings regardless of a rising listing of issues plaguing the corporate. The automaker’s combined efficiency final 12 months had led many to query whether or not Mr. Musk’s focus and a spotlight on Twitter had meant that he was neglecting his duties at Tesla.

Mr. Musk deflected that criticism on the earnings name, suggesting that his tens of millions of Twitter followers have been an indication of his recognition.

“I may not be common with some individuals,” he stated, “however for the overwhelming majority of individuals, my follower depend speaks for itself.”
